Font Size: a A A

Dynamical Enterprise Application Integration And Technical Realization

Posted on:2006-03-22Degree:MasterType:Thesis
Country:ChinaCandidate:G D NiuFull Text:PDF
GTID:2178360212482170Subject:Electrical theory and new technology
Abstract/Summary:PDF Full Text Request
Enterprise's information construction has developed for more than 20 years, has experiences three stages of technical application unit, enterprise's information integration and information integration of cross-enterprise. Although the amount of information systems is from zero to more, and function become more and more strong, it hinder flow of enterprise message because lack of unified planning or different systems that exits in a firm due to Enterprise annexation to construct system because of what enterprise annexation. That is the demand for integration of information system in enterprises. In recent years, with forming a whole of economic world and perfect competition of the market, all enterprises of one trade from producing the material to selling products can't win the competition unless jointing together. Following this, the business among enterprises becomes mutual and close, and the information systems needs seamless connection to reduce the cost of information flowing. This is the third stage: information integration of cross- enterprises.Integration of the enterprise information systems is enterprise focal point in information field, and many people put forward a lot of integrated modes from different respects. Enterprise Application Integration is one kind mode, and it is the combination of hardware, software, standard and business procedure which connect two and more systems together seamlessly and run as a whole. In different periods, the content of EAI is different, and now it not only includes integration of application systems and organizations in each level inside enterprises, but also realizes the system integration of cross-enterprises. This paper reviews three stages of enterprise's information and present focuses that integrating information system of cross-enterprise, and enumerate the advantages which used enterprise application integration to realize information integration of cross-enterprise firstly. Then I compared several kinds of similar concepts, and divides EAI into three layers from the logic of understanding: users display layer, function layer, data layer. In this chapter, I will analyze three ways which used to realize function layer, and compare three structures of components, three ways of connection and characters. Through the above analysis, the main purpose is to help enterprises choose the most suitable frame and technology according to actual conditions.Because the market competed hard, the life cycle of products and service is shortened, and the customer has more choices. Enterprises need introduce new products and service rapidly to attract the customer and improve the competitiveness. With the changes of the service and products, enterprise's business will change. To increase no or little business cost, the information systems of enterprises must adapted and increased by oneself, the systematic function can use again. This requires systematic function module take high and cohesive, low coupling, and separatesystematic business logic from application procedure. System can use the concrete function according to the business logic dynamically. Web service frame based on SOA (Service Oriented Architecture) satisfied this kind of demand, and it was the best software frame that use to realize integration of cross-enterprise information systems. This paper introduced the essential feature of web services briefly, and proposed a kind of enterprise application integration based on web services. This platform includes three parts mainly: web service technical standard and norm and application server; various kinds of engines, including transaction management engine, procedure engine, SOAP router and adapter; application integrated ,monitor service, information service console, and so on. Those completed management of procedure, application resource and unified interface mainly. In order to define and adjust the commercial logic and procedure again, the paper introduced the thought of business procedure management, and study those function and module that a business procedure administrative system should have. The system mainly manages modeling procedure, executing procedure, measuring performance, optimizing procedure, and has done more research to model procedure, and analyzed several kinds of modeling languages, select a kind of best modeling language. This paper demonstrates the course of modeling procedure, converting model, and display model through one instance based on this kind of modeling language.This paper mainly discussed how realizes dynamic system integration, and enable information system changing with increasing of demand. The system realizes dynamics from three respects: realizing function, transferring the method and managing procedure. Like a bunch of necklace, function acts as pearl, transferring way acts as line, and business procedure management charges how organizes pearl in certain order.
Keywords/Search Tags:Enterprise Application Integration EAI, Web Services, Business Procedure Management BPM
PDF Full Text Request
Related items